description: Pseudoalteromonas telluritireducens Se-1-2-red is a mesophilic, motile bacterium that was isolated from near deep ocean hydrothermal vent.

Culture and growth conditions
culture medium
- @ref: 6293
- name: BACTO MARINE BROTH (DIFCO 2216) (DSMZ Medium 514)
- growth: yes
- link: https://mediadive.dsmz.de/medium/514
- composition: Name: BACTO MARINE BROTH (DIFCO 2216) (DSMZ Medium 514; with strain-specific modifications) Composition: NaCl 19.45 g/l Na acetate 10.0 g/l MgCl2 5.9 g/l Bacto peptone 5.0 g/l Na2SO4 3.24 g/l CaCl2 1.8 g/l Yeast extract 1.0 g/l KCl 0.55 g/l NaHCO3 0.16 g/l Fe(III) citrate 0.1 g/l KBr 0.08 g/l SrCl2 0.034 g/l H3BO3 0.022 g/l Na2HPO4 0.008 g/l Na-silicate 0.004 g/l NaF 0.0024 g/l (NH4)NO3 0.0016 g/l Distilled water
culture temp
- @ref: 6293
- growth: positive
- type: growth
- temperature: 30
- range: mesophilic
